Join us to learn how to write, publish and market your book.

Write Your Book - With the Myles Method.

Write. Publish. Market.

An In-Person Workshop for Aspiring Authors

Do you want to improve your writing style?
Would you like to know how to publish your book for free?
Are you looking for practical, easy-to-apply marketing tips?

If you answered yes to any of these, this session is for you.

Join us in person for a supportive, practical workshop where you’ll meet other writers, share ideas, and learn some of the real-world tricks of the trade. This is about progress, not perfection — and taking the next confident step with your book.

Tea and coffee provided

What you’ll learn:

  • How to improve your writing style and build confidence as an author
  • How to write a compelling book blurb that attracts readers
  • How to use AI ethically and effectively to support your writing and marketing
  • How to publish your book for free
  • How to find the right publisher for your book
  • Practical marketing tips to help your book get noticed

Your host is Fiona Myles, an experienced author who has written and published over ten books, including children’s books, memoirs, self-help titles, and a novel. Fiona has also helped many others to write, publish, and market their own books successfully.

This two-hour session will cover the essentials and give you clear direction, practical tools, and renewed motivation to move your book forward.

Come with an idea. Leave with clarity.
